Hi plugin folks — quick handover on the Quillcheck baseline file. Marek regenerated it last sprint, so any new findings your plugins raise are genuinely new, not legacy noise. Don't hand-edit the baseline; use the refresh task instead, or the diff gets ugly fast. For reference, the analysis service runs with the configuration values below.

settings of tajep-tafog:
CASDOR_LOG_LEVEL=info
CASDOR_METRICS_HOST=metrics.casdor.nelvrosys.internal
CASDOR_POOL_SIZE=16

## Authentication

Glacierbin archives cold storage buckets nightly. Release managers trigger manual archive runs only during cutover windows. Auth is via the Frostgate internal service; no user tokens, no OAuth. The key is scoped to archive:write and expires every 90 days — rotation is your responsibility before each release freeze. Do not reuse staging keys in prod; Frostgate rejects cross-environment credentials silently and the archive job will hang. Check the job log for AUTH_DENIED before escalating. The key to use for prod runs is below.

gateway credential: kto3_qfe

## Environments: Build agents and clock skew

Heads up, plugin authors: the Corvid CI staging pool has agents spread across two racks, and we've seen skew of up to 40 seconds between them. If your plugin compares artifact timestamps or signs manifests with a validity window, build in some slack — tight windows are the top cause of flaky staging runs. Production agents sync more aggressively. The staging pool's time-sync daemon uses these settings.

config for baweg-fahop:
[praael]
host = praael.qorvellabs.corp
user = praael_svc
database = praael_prod

Hi Marisol — welcome aboard. Quick handover: the Brindlewood expansion budget request is still sitting with group finance. I've pushed twice; Teodor says a decision lands next week. Don't let it slip — the warehouse lease in Calver Point depends on it. Full context is in the confidential note below.

confidential, kajof-tahof: The pricing group signed off on a budget of $491.8 million for Project Casvan.